In 'I Dwell in Possibility', by Emily Dckinson, the author compares her vocation as poet to prose, through a metaphor of the two as houses.

She feels poetry as an open and ilimeted house, whereas she sees prose as limeted and enclosed.

She also relates poetry to leaving in freedom in nature and prose to be like living in cage.
